Buy The Sneaker is set to release the new Air Jordan 34 Low that comes with some retro-inspired prints from previous Air Jordan models. This low top Air Jordan 34 comes dressed in a Black, Laser orange and White color combination. The unique abstract design is similar to what we have seen on the Air Jordan 7. In addition we have elephant print on the heel while cement print covers the midsole which is taken from the Air Jordan 3 and the Air Jordan 4. Other details includes Red on the Jumpman located on the tongue, an Orange Jumpman on the heel while White and Blue covers the outsole to finish the look.
